Fixing it with GOOP or rubber cement will increase the Mms of the woofer, tht will lower Fs and reduce the Acceleration Factor. + Amazing GOOP Adhesive Products 0409
If you are using this woofer in a sealed box and are very careful with applying the rubber cement (thin layer) you should be ok. Otherwise you will ahve to ask JL to send you a reconing kit and go to a speaker repair workshop. |
